The Child Is Father of the Man     (Wordsworth 1802)


Our time here -
t'was like the night before
the Père Noël delivers
with the Miracle Lift

just the body in a body bag
the gift of Life
being never wrapped up like a Christo

just the body suited to the myth
Santa's sack emptied
now the brother-man is full-filled
spent on childhood


Humanhood - the father & mother of brother & sister hood


As my father
borne on a February 10th
lies down to rest
on the postmas eve 1997

and like a star dozing off
on a learjet after a whirlwind tour
the leading man
17 light years before his lady
still leading their newborns
like their mothers & fathers before them
receives the Miracle Lift

the two on board as one
travelling one way - to Thy kingdom come
what really happens on earth
doesn't stay on earth
from the start of their heart
both AoA - all Alive on Arrival -
Home

silence is never
dead to the world
just resting
in heavenly peace

the lull
without a bye

I am following to find them
expecting me There too
in the nursery of Our Father's
Haven of the Humane


A real celebration waiting for us all     (Chicago "Saturday in the Park" 1973)
